You can use below format for only positive no. upto 99,99,99,999.99
[>=10000000]##\,##\,##\,##0.00; [>=100000]##\,##\,##0.00;##,##0.00

Note that this doesn't work for negative numbers, and (AFAIK) cannot be
extended to negative numbers as it runs out of options.
